Our Expert Tree Trimming & Pruning Services in Otter Rock, OR

Crown Cleaning

Crown cleaning is the meticulous removal of dead, dying, diseased, broken, or weakly attached branches from a tree's crown. This process, also known as deadwooding, is crucial for hazard reduction. It eliminates potential falling hazards and prevents the spread of decay, significantly improving overall tree vitality.

Crown Thinning

Crown thinning involves the selective removal of branches throughout the crown to reduce density. Strategic canopy thinning lightens the load on individual branches, enhancing wind resistance and reducing the likelihood of storm damage. It discourages fungal growth and promotes even foliage development.

Crown Raising (Lifting)

Crown raising, or lifting, is the removal of the lowest branches from a tree's crown to provide clear space beneath. This lower limb removal provides necessary clearance pruning for pedestrian and vehicle traffic, ensuring safety and improving visibility around your Otter Rock property.

Crown Reduction

Crown reduction is a technique used to decrease the height or spread of a tree. This managed size reduction is typically performed on larger trees to alleviate stress, improve structural integrity, or reduce interference with utilities or structures. It is a precise method of structural pruning that preserves form and health.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: How often should trees be trimmed in Otter Rock?

A: The optimal frequency depends on species, age, and health. Generally, mature trees benefit from pruning every $3-5$ years. Younger trees may require more frequent, annual structural pruning. Our arborists at Chase Tree Service can provide a tailored maintenance plan for your property.

Q: What's the best time of year for tree trimming in OR?

A: For most deciduous trees, late fall or early winter (the dormant season) is ideal. However, certain types of pruning, such as removing dead, diseased, or hazardous limbs, can and should be performed year-round as soon as they are identified.

Q: What is the difference between trimming and pruning?

A: "Pruning" is a horticultural practice to improve tree health or structure. "Trimming" is a broader term often referring to cutting back overgrowth for general maintenance. At Chase Tree Service, we perform precise pruning techniques for the long-term well-being of your trees.

Q: Will trimming or pruning hurt my tree?

A: When performed correctly by a qualified arborist, it is essential for health. However, improper techniques like "topping" can severely damage a tree. Our experts make strategic cuts that minimize stress and promote healthy healing.
